Like many other professional surfers, Kahanamoku and Hamilton were/are watermen. Other than his 3 Gold, 2 Silver, and 1 Bronze Olympic swimming medals, Kahanamoku was still a legend when competitive surfing didn't exist. He was a surfing ambassador more than anything. Hamilton has always stayed away from contest. He has always been his own man, and doesn't give a damn about the competitive surfing culture.

Being a professional surfer is a 365 24/7 job. The ASP Tour has an 11 month season. When these guys aren't competing, surfers are globe trotting looking for the biggest, knarliest, and most dangerous waves in the world. When they are doing it, these guys surf from sun-up to sundown.
